Sewer Line Repair in New Kingston: what the job involves
Most sewer laterals in older New Kingston neighbourhoods are clay, cast iron or Orangeburg, and each one fails in its own way. Clay opens at the joints and lets roots in. Cast iron scales and channels along the bottom. Orangeburg deforms into an oval and then collapses. A camera survey tells us which of those we are dealing with and exactly how far from the house it is.
From there the honest answer is usually a spot repair rather than a full replacement. We dig the section that failed, replace it in PVC with proper bedding, and leave you a cleanout you can actually use. Where the line runs under a driveway, porch or mature tree, we look at trenchless options before anybody breaks concrete.

How do you know where to dig?
The camera carries a sonde and we locate it from the surface, so we know depth and position before a shovel goes in the ground. That is what keeps the excavation small.
Repair or full replacement?
If the rest of the line is sound and one joint failed, repair that joint. If the line is Orangeburg or the camera shows failure along the whole run, patching it is throwing money at a pipe that is going to fail again.
Do I need a permit?
Most New York municipalities require a permit for sewer lateral work and some require an inspection before backfill. We handle the paperwork as part of the job.
What should I do while I wait for the plumber?
Close your main water shut-off, then open the lowest faucet in the house to relieve pressure in the pipes. If the water is near anything electrical, cut power to that area at the panel. If you smell gas, leave the building and call your gas utility from outside.
